1. Congress Forgives $10,000 In Student Loans For Americans

The President announced his administration’s long-awaited student loan forgiveness plan recently, saying it will forgive $10,000 in student loans for borrowers who earned less than $125,000 during the pandemic. People who received Pell Grants, grants to low-income students, while they were enrolled in college will be eligible to have $20,000 in debt forgiven.
The move will be enough to wipe out some student debt entirely: 15 million of the 43 million people with federal loans owe less than $10,000, and those borrowers are typically the most likely to fail to pay back their loans. In all, the plan will eliminate student debt for about 20 million people, according to an analysis provided by the Education Department, and decrease monthly payments by an average of $250 for borrowers with a remaining balance who are on standard 10-year payment plans.

4. Emergency Bans on Evictions and Other Tenant Protections

The federal government, as well as many any states, cities, and counties are taking steps to minimize the impact of the novel coronavirus crisis on tenants, including placing moratoriums on evictions, holds on shutting off utilities due to nonpayment, and prohibiting late rent fees.

On September 1, 2020 the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) issued an Agency Order titled Temporary Halt in Residential Evictions to Prevent the Further Spread of COVID-19 (Order). The Order went into effect on September 4, 2020, and prohibits residential landlords nationwide from evicting certain tenants through December 31, 2020. The Order protects tenants who:
– have used their best efforts to obtain government assistance for housing
– are unable to pay their full rent due to a substantial loss of income
– are making their best efforts to make timely partial payments of rent, and
– would become homeless or have to move into a shared living setting if they were to be evicted.
In addition to the above requirements, one of the following financial criteria must apply. To qualify for protection, tenants must:
– expect to earn no more than $99,000 (individuals) or $198,000 (filing joint tax return) in 2020
– not have been required to report any income to the IRS in 2019, or
– have received an Economic Impact Payment (stimulus check) pursuant to Section 2201 of the CARES Act.

5. Paid Sick Leave

Another recently enacted federal law, the Families First Coronavirus Response Act, requires certain companies to provide paid sick leave for up to two weeks if a worker has to be quarantined or is experiencing symptoms of a coronavirus infection and is seeking a medical diagnosis.
There is also a provision for workers to receive paid sick leave if they are unable to work because they are caring for someone else.

7. Take Full Advantage Of These Tax Deductions

Owning a home can be very lucrative. Seriously, owning a home can not only give you a cheaper monthly payment than renting but in many cases, the tax benefits make the decision a no-brainer.

Here are a few of the larger deductions that you need to be sure to take:

Interest you pay on your mortgage: If you own a home and don’t have a mortgage greater than $750,000, you can deduct the interest you pay on the loan. This is one of the biggest benefits to owning a home versus renting–as you could get massive deductions at tax time. The limit used to be $1 million, but the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act of 2017 (TCJA) reduced the limit and made some clarifications on deducting interest from a home equity line of credit.
Property taxes: Another awesome benefit to owning a home is the ability to deduct your property taxes. Before TCJA, the rules were a little more flexible and you were able to deduct the entirety of your property taxes. Now things have a changed a bit. Under the new law, you can deduct up to $10,000. The deduction for state and local income taxes was combined with the deduction for state and local property taxes, too.
Tax incentives for energy-efficient upgrades: While most of the tax incentives for making energy-efficient upgrades to your home have gone away, there are still a couple worth noting. You can still claim tax deductions on solar energy–both for electric and water heating equipment, through 2021. The longer you wait, though, the less money you’ll get back. Here’s the percentage of equipment you can deduct, based on time of installation:
Between January 1, 2017, and December 31, 2019 – 30% of the expenditures are eligible for the credit
Between January 1, 2020, and December 31, 2020 – 26%
Between January 1, 2021, and December 31, 2021 – 22%.

9. Advance Child Tax Credit

By claiming the Child Tax Credit (CTC), you can reduce the amount of money you owe on your federal taxes. The amount of credit you receive is based on your income and the number of qualifying children you are claiming.
Because of the COVID-19 pandemic, the CTC was expanded under the American Rescue Plan of 2021. The IRS pre-paid half the total credit amount in monthly payments from July to December 2021. When you file your 2021 tax return, you can claim the other half of the total CTC.

10. Get Help Buying Food With SNAP If You’re In Need

SNAP helps you buy the food you need for good health and nutrition. With SNAP, you get benefits on a special debit card on a monthly basis. You can use the card to get food at many grocery stores, as well as through some senior centers or home-delivered meal programs. Also, SNAP has free programs to help with healthy eating habits and physical activity.
SNAP is not for everyone. SNAP is made available to those truly in need.

11. Clean Vehicle Rebate Program (CVRP)

Get up to $7,000 to purchase or lease a new plug-in hybrid electric vehicle (PHEV), battery electric vehicle (BEV), or a fuel cell electric vehicle (FCEV).
CVRP offers vehicle rebates on a first-come, first-served basis and helps get the cleanest vehicles on the road in California by providing consumer rebates to reduce the initial cost of advanced technologies. Rebates are available to California residents that meet income requirements and purchase or lease an eligible vehicle.
